Changelog 4.2.0 — hot-reload defaults changed. Werrin's config watcher now debounces file events at 500 ms instead of 50 ms, and partial reloads are off by default; a malformed fragment no longer takes half the settings live. On-call: if a service appears to ignore edits, wait out the debounce before assuming a hang. Rollback requires a full restart, not a SIGHUP. The new default values ship as follows.

service settings:
[quenath]
host = quenath.zemvarcorp.corp
user = quenath_svc
database = quenath_prod

## Formula sandbox tuning

User-supplied formulas in Gridmoor execute inside a restricted interpreter with hard ceilings on time, memory, and call depth. Reviewers should confirm any change to these ceilings is justified in the PR description, since raising them widens the abuse surface. Defaults were chosen from production traces. The current limits are as follows.

limits module of tafog-fawip:
WEIGHTS = {
    "julix": 57,
    "lamys": 992,
    "kasvan": 209,
    "quenok": 750,
    "alddor": 259,
    "oliath": 1009,
    "wenix": 815,
}

Minutes — Management Meeting, Lease Renegotiation

Prepared for the incoming director. Attendees: P. Averling (chair), K. Moreno, T. Selwick. The Farrowgate warehouse lease expires in March; landlord Quillstone Estates proposes a 12% uplift. We countered with a five-year term at a 4% uplift plus a break clause at year three. Legal review is underway; fallback site is the Dellmoor depot. Decision expected within three weeks. The confidential plan informing our negotiating position is noted below.

internal memo for kawip-hadug: Headcount on the Wenwyn team goes from 7 to 140 by the end of January. Gross margin on Wenwyn came in at 20 percent against a plan of 15 percent.